I want to share with you an interesting drink. In summer, an unusual combination of cranberries and roses can be served as a refreshing lemonade. And in the cold winter - as a warming tonic drink.

Ingredients

Directions

  1. 1. Prepare all necessary products. We need tea rose flowers (dry 10 g, fresh - 30 g), rose jam, or jam. Cranberries can be taken frozen or fresh. Use a sweetener, if necessary, according to your taste.
  2. 2. In a suitable container, send cranberries (if the cranberries are frozen, then you do not need to defrost them), tea rose flowers, jam, or rose jam. Pour 200 ml of boiled water and crush cranberries so that they give juice. Pour in the remaining boiled water. The water must be hot. Allow the infusion to cool and refrigerate for 8 hours (or more).
  3. 3. Take out the infusion from the refrigerator. Strain, and squeeze cranberries with rose well. And strain again. At this stage, a delicious drink is already obtained, ready to drink.
